Are you sure you can't switch to discreet from BIOS on the dv6? It should be in the 'advanced BIOS'. Try F10 + A to boot into advanced BIOS. A have a dm4-1xxx series and it offers it even for a old muxed intel+ati model. I thought all HP muxed ones work the same way.
